A man has been charged with two counts of murder after human remains were found in suitcases in Bristol and a London flat. Yostin Andres Mosquera, 34, will appear in court today. The victims have been named as 62-year-old Albert Alfonso, a French-British citizen, and 71-year-old Paul Longworth, a British national. Mosquera was arrested in Bristol on Saturday and charged in the early hours of Monday.
